IP address 166.80.0.123 lookup, whois and location finder

IP address  166.80.0.123
166.80.0.123  United States
IPv4
166.80.0.123
The Future Now
The Future Now
166.80.0.0 - 166.80.255.255
America/Los_Angeles (UTC-7)
United States 
California
San Francisco
37.789798736572, -122.39420318604
Show
Connection type corporate
IP on map